Loriday 10mg (Loratadine) – Affordable Claritin Alternative
Loriday 10 mg is a prescription medicine used to treat allergic rhinitis (hay fever) and urticaria (hives or allergic skin rash). The active ingredient of the medicine is Loratadine, an antihistamine medication used to relieve various conditions, including pruritus (itchy skin), runny nose, watery eyes, and sneezing associated with seasonal allergies. Loriday provide relief from symptoms such as a runny or blocked nose, sneezing, and itchy or watery eyes. It is also effective in relieving allergic reactions caused by insect bites, as well as symptoms of hives and eczema, including itching, rash, irritation, and swelling. This will enhance the appearance of your skin, and you may also notice an improvement in your mood and self-confidence.
Loratadine tablets reduce your allergy symptoms by stopping the effects called histamine, which is naturally released by the body when you are allergic to something. This antihistamine drug is fast-acting and has a long duration of action (24 hours). Moreover, the medication may make you less sleepy than other antihistamine drugs. Precautions and warnings with Loriday 10mg Loratadine tablet
Do not take Loriday 10 mg if you have a history of hypersensitivity reaction to Loratadine or to any of the inactive ingredients of the formulation. Let your healthcare specialist know before taking Loriday tablets if you have severe liver problems. Do not consume Loratadine for at least two days before undergoing skin tests for allergies. This is because the antihistamine formulation may affect the test results. The medication is not recommended for children younger than 6 years old or for those weighing 30 kg or less. There are alternative medications that are more suitable for children under six years of age or those with a body weight of 30 kg or less.
The side effects of Loriday 10 mg may increase when used in combination with medications that have the potential to affect the function of certain enzymes that are responsible for drug metabolism in the liver. Therefore, it is essential to inform your healthcare specialist about all the medications you are currently taking, have recently taken, or may take in the future. This includes any medications obtained without a prescription. Pregnant and breastfeeding women should ask their healthcare specialist for advice before taking the medicine. Avoid taking the Loratadine tablets if you are breastfeeding, as this medication can pass into the breast milk.
Side effects of the Loriday 10mg Loratadine tablet
Like all medications, use of Loriday 10 mg can cause side effects; not everybody gets them. The most commonly occurring adverse effects in adults and children are headache, trouble sleeping, and increased appetite. Common side effects observed in children aged 6 to 12 years include headache, fatigue, and nervousness. Rare but serious side effects of Loratadine 10 mg include rash, convulsions, nausea, dizziness, rapid heartbeat, palpitations, abnormal liver function, dry mouth, and hair loss. If you experience any side effects, please consult your healthcare specialist.

How does Loratadine work in the body?
Loratadine functions as a selective peripheral histamine H1-receptor antagonist that blocks the action of histamine, a chemical your body releases during allergic reactions. When you encounter allergens, histamine binds to receptors causing inflammation, itching, and mucus production. Loriday 10mg prevents this binding without crossing the blood-brain barrier significantly, which explains why it causes minimal drowsiness compared to first-generation antihistamines. The medicine reaches peak concentration within one to two hours and maintains allergy relief throughout the day. This targeted mechanism makes Loratadine an effective hay fever treatment while allowing patients to stay alert and focused.
How long does Loriday 10mg take to work?
Loriday 10mg typically begins providing allergy relief within 1 to 3 hours after taking the tablet. Most patients notice improvement in symptoms like sneezing, itchy eyes, and runny nose within this timeframe, with maximum effectiveness reached around 8 to 12 hours post-dose. The antihistamine effect of Loratadine continues for a full 24 hours, offering all-day protection from hay fever symptoms with just one daily tablet. For best results with seasonal allergies, some healthcare providers recommend starting this allergy medicine a few days before expected allergen exposure to build consistent blood levels.

Can I take Loriday 10mg with other medicines?
Loratadine in Loriday 10mg has fewer drug interactions than many antihistamines, but precautions still apply. Avoid combining it with other allergy medicines containing antihistamines to prevent excessive dosing. Some medications like ketoconazole, erythromycin, and cimetidine may increase Loratadine levels in your blood. Alcohol doesn't typically interact significantly with this non-drowsy formula, though individual responses vary. This allergy tablet can usually be taken alongside most blood pressure medications, pain relievers, and antibiotics. Always inform your doctor and pharmacist about all medications, supplements, and herbal products you're taking to screen for potential interactions with your hay fever treatment.
How does Loriday 10mg compare to similar medicines in its class?
Loriday 10mg contains Loratadine, a second-generation antihistamine comparable to cetirizine and fexofenadine in treating allergic rhinitis. Unlike cetirizine, which causes mild drowsiness in some patients, Loratadine has an even lower sedation profile. Compared to fexofenadine, this allergy medication works similarly but may be taken with or without food more flexibly. Loratadine provides equivalent symptom relief to these alternatives at standard doses. While all three are effective hay fever treatments, patient response varies—some find Loriday works better for their specific symptoms. Price and availability often influence choice, with generic Loratadine options offering excellent value without compromising efficacy.
Is the generic Loratadine as effective as branded versions?
Generic Loratadine is therapeutically equivalent to branded versions like Loriday 10mg, containing the identical active ingredient at the same strength. Regulatory agencies in the USA, UK, Australia, and Canada require generic antihistamines to demonstrate bioequivalence—meaning they're absorbed and work in your body identically to brand-name products. The same allergy relief, duration of action, and safety profile apply whether you choose generic or branded options. Any differences lie only in inactive ingredients like fillers or coatings, which rarely affect efficacy. Many patients and healthcare providers confidently choose generic Loratadine for hay fever treatment, benefiting from significant cost savings while receiving the same quality allergy medicine.

Who should avoid taking Loratadine?
People with known hypersensitivity or allergic reactions to Loratadine or any antihistamine ingredients should avoid this medication. Those with severe liver disease require careful evaluation before using this allergy medicine, as the liver metabolizes Loratadine and impaired function may affect drug clearance. Pregnant women should discuss risks and benefits with their doctor, particularly during the first trimester. While Loratadine passes into breast milk in small amounts, nursing mothers should consult healthcare providers before use. Children under two years old should not take this antihistamine without medical supervision. Patients with phenylketonuria should check formulations carefully, as some dispersible versions contain phenylalanine. Always disclose your complete medical history when considering hay fever treatments.
